More information about Côtes du Roussillon Villages AOP - Calmel & Joseph

The Côtes du Roussillon Villages from the wine-growing region of the Languedoc presents itself in the glass in dense purple. The first nose of the Côtes du Roussillon Villages presents nuances of plums, morello cherries and blueberries. The fruity components of the bouquet are joined by more fruity-balsamic nuances.

The Calmel & Joseph Côtes du Roussillon Villages presents itself pleasantly dry to the wine lover. This red wine is never coarse or sparse, but round and smooth. On the palate, the texture of this powerful red wine is wonderfully dense. Due to the balanced fruit acidity, the Côtes du Roussillon Villages flatters with a velvety mouthfeel, without lacking juicy liveliness. The finale of this red wine with good aging potential from the Languedoc wine region, more precisely from Cotes du Roussillon, finally thrills with a beautiful reverberation. The finish is also accompanied by mineral hints of the soils dominated by sandstone and clay.

Vinification of the Côtes du Roussillon Villages by Calmel & Joseph

This powerful red wine from France is made from Carignan, Grenache and Syrah grapes. In Languedoc, the vines that produce the grapes for this wine grow on soils of slate, sandstone and clay. After the hand harvest, the grapes arrive at the winery by the fastest route. Here they are sorted and carefully crushed. Then fermentation takes place in the at controlled temperatures. Food recommendation for the Côtes du Roussillon Villages by Calmel & Joseph

This red wine from France is best enjoyed tempered at 15 - 18°C. It is perfect to accompany roasted calf's liver with apples, onions and balsamic vinegar sauce, duck breast with sugar snap peas or goose breast with ginger red cabbage and marjoram.
